Against the background of austere and beautiful Aberdeen, Woolfson observes the seasons, the streets and the quiet places of her city over the course of a year. She considers the geographic, atmospheric and environmental elements which bring diverse life forms together in close proximity, and in absorbing prose writes of the animals among us: the birds, the rats and squirrels, the spiders and the insects.
Her close
examination of the natural world leads her to question our prevailing
attitudes to urban and non-urban wildlife, and to look again at the
values we place on the lives of individual species.
